Product Description of ProSoft MVI69-DFNT
MVI69-DFNT (EtherNet/IP Client/Server Communication Module) is an EtherNet/IP client/server communication module specially designed by ProSoft for the Rockwell CompactLogix/MicroLogix 1500 platform. Through a single 10/100Mbps Ethernet interface, it supports EtherNet/IP explicit messages (Explicit Messaging), and can be used as a client to actively read and write remote devices, or as a server to respond to external commands, enabling high-speed Ethernet interconnection between CompactLogix and multiple EtherNet/IP devices, PLCs, HMI, and SCADA systems.

II. Core Hardware Specifications
Compatible Platforms:
CompactLogix: L20, L30, L35, L43, L45 (L43/L45 need to be installed in the first 2 slots of the rack) MicroLogix 1500 LRP
Incompatibility: 1769-L23E-QBFC1B, 1769-L16x, 1769-L18x
Slot occupation: Single slot (standard 1769 size)
Power consumption of the backplane: 800mA @ 5.1VDC
Ethernet interface (1 port):
Standard: 10/100Base-TX adaptive
Connector: RJ45
Isolation: 1500Vrms electrical isolation
IP configuration: Static IP / DHCP automatic acquisition
Configuration port (CFG): RS-232 (RJ45 → DB9), used for module configuration, firmware upgrade
Internal database: Maximum 4000 register (users can customize data mapping)
Client commands: Up to 100 configurable EtherNet/IP commands
Server connections: Up to 20 concurrent server connections
LED status: OK, APP, ERR, LINK, ACT five groups of indicator lights
Operating temperature: 0°C ~ +60°C
Storage temperature: -40°C ~ +85°C
Humidity: 5% ~ 95% (no condensation)
Anti-interference: Vibration 5g, shock 30g (running) / 50g (non-running)
Certification: CE, UL, cURus, RoHS
III. Core Functions and Performance
1. EtherNet/IP protocol support (core advantage)
Dual mode operation:
Client (Client): Sends read/write commands actively to remote EtherNet/IP devices (PLC, HMI, driver)
Server (Server): Responds to read/write requests from external master station (PLC, SCADA, upper computer)
Explicit messages: Supports EtherNet/IP Explicit Messaging (DF1 protocol encapsulation)
Multiple devices concurrency:
Client: Polls multiple remote devices simultaneously
Server: Accepts up to 20 master station connections simultaneously
Command optimization: Supports command queue, automatic retry, timeout handling, error status reporting
Data types: Supports integer, floating-point, string and other data formats
2. Ethernet communication performance
Transmission rate: 10/100Mbps full-duplex / half-duplex adaptive
Data delay: < 5ms (Ethernet data exchange)
Connection number: 100 commands for client / 20 connections for server
Network isolation: 1500Vrms isolation, protects PLC from network surges, interference
3. Backplane high-speed communication (PLC interaction)
Asynchronous data exchange: Module and PLC data interaction is independent of Ethernet, does not occupy PLC scanning time
Data mapping: 4000 bytes internal database, directly maps PLC controller labels
Interaction mode:
Periodic I/O data mirroring
Ladder diagram AOI, MSG instruction control
Real-time reporting of status, error codes
Transmission delay: < 1ms (high-speed backplane bus)
4. Configuration and diagnosis
Configuration software: ProSoft Configuration Builder (PCB)
Visual configuration of IP, client commands, server parameters, data mapping
Configuration file download, backup, batch copying
Online diagnosis:
Ethernet connection status, traffic monitoring, error count
Client command execution status, response time, failure retry
Module operation log, fault code, health status

V. Typical Application Scenarios
Multi-PLC Ethernet Networking: CompactLogix connects with ControlLogix, PLC-5, SLC 500 and other AB PLCs
EtherNet/IP Device Access: Connect servo drives, frequency converters, intelligent instruments, sensors, etc. via EtherNet/IP
SCADA/HMI Monitoring: Acts as a server, responding to real-time monitoring from upper computers and SCADA systems
Cross-Network Data Gateway: Data forwarding and protocol conversion between different workshops and factory EtherNet/IP networks
Renovating Old Equipment: Old non-Ethernet equipment connects to CompactLogix Ethernet system through modules
Distributed I/O Expansion: Remote EtherNet/IP I/O modules connected to local CompactLogix controllers
